Lychee Rose Frappe

Delightful Lychee Rose Frappe for a Refreshing Summer Treat

This Lychee Rose Frappe is a refreshing summer drink that combines the sweetness of lychee with floral rose notes.
Prep Time 5 minutes
Total Time 5 minutes
Servings: 2 cups
Course: Drinks
Cuisine: Asian
Calories: 120

Ingredients
  

For the Frappe
  • 1 can Canned Lychee Consider using fresh lychees for a fresher taste if available.
  • 3 tablespoons Lychee Syrup Reserving some syrup from the canned lychee is recommended.
  • 2 tablespoons Rose Syrup Using Rooh Afza or similar brands is ideal.
  • 2 cups Ice Cubes Creates a frosty texture.
  • 1 cup Cold Water or Milk Use milk for added richness or water for a lighter drink.
  • for garnish Dried Rose Petals or Whole Lychee Enhances presentation and adds an aromatic touch.

Equipment

  • Blender

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Lychee Rose Frappe
  1. Begin by draining the canned lychee, reserving the syrup. If using fresh lychees, peel and pit them. Gather all ingredients.
  2. In a blender, combine lychee, reserved syrup, rose syrup, and cold water or milk. Blend on high for about 30 seconds until smooth.
  3. Add ice cubes to the mixture and blend again on high for an additional 30 seconds until the ice is finely crushed.
  4. Pour the frothy mixture into chilled glasses and garnish with dried rose petals or a whole lychee. Serve immediately.

Notes

This frosty drink is best enjoyed immediately after preparation but can be stored in an airtight container for up to 24 hours.
